4723-8-10 Continuing education requirements.

(A) Each advanced practice nurse who obtains continuing nursing education in their the nurse’s area of practice for the purpose of obtaining or maintaining a national certification may use those continuing education hours to satisfy the continuing education requirements set forth in section 4723.24 of the Revised Code and Chapter 4723-14 of the Administrative Code. Such continuing nursing education shall be accrued in the twenty-four months immediately preceding the renewal of the license to practice nursing as a registered nurse.

(B) Each clinical nurse specialist who is not certified by a national nursing certifying organization approved by the board shall obtain twelve contact hours of continuing nursing education in addition to the twenty-four hours every two years required for renewal of a license to practice nursing as a registered nurse. The additional hours shall be in programs which are targeted to advanced practice nurses in the nurse’s area of practice or in relevant programs from other health care disciplines.

(C) To satisfy the requirements of this rule, a continuing education activity shall be approved in accordance with Chapter 4723-14 of the Administrative Code.

(D) A clinical nurse specialist who is not certified by a national certifying organization may not request the waiver option contained in rule 4723-14-03 of the Administrative Code for the additional twelve contact hours of continuing nursing education required in paragraph (B) of this rule.

(E) Monitoring of compliance with the continuing nursing education requirement for each advanced practice nurse shall be in accordance with Chapter 4723-14 of the Administrative Code.
